-
- 簡單的PHP電子郵件:復(fù)制和粘貼代碼示例
- 使用PHP發(fā)送郵件可以簡單或復(fù)雜,具體取決于需求。1)使用內(nèi)置的mail()函數(shù)適合基本需求。2)對于更復(fù)雜的需求,建議使用如PHPMailer的SMTP庫,提供更好的控制和功能。
- php教程 . 后端開發(fā) 461 2025-05-21 00:08:10
-
- PHP中如何實現(xiàn)數(shù)組頻率統(tǒng)計?
- 在PHP中實現(xiàn)數(shù)組頻率統(tǒng)計可以使用array_count_values函數(shù)。1)該函數(shù)適用于整數(shù)和字符串數(shù)組,如$array=[1,2,2,3,3,3,4,4,4,4];使用array_count_values($array)可得各元素頻率。2)對于更復(fù)雜的數(shù)據(jù)類型或需要更細致控制時,可自定義統(tǒng)計函數(shù),如統(tǒng)計對象數(shù)組中某個屬性的頻率,需遍歷數(shù)組并手動計數(shù)。
- php教程 . 后端開發(fā) 686 2025-05-20 18:27:01
-
- PHP中<<運算符有什么用?
- 在PHP中,實現(xiàn)多態(tài)性可以通過方法重寫、接口和類型提示來實現(xiàn)。1)方法重寫:子類重寫父類方法,根據(jù)對象類型執(zhí)行不同行為。2)接口:類實現(xiàn)多個接口實現(xiàn)多態(tài)性。3)類型提示:確保函數(shù)參數(shù)特定類型,實現(xiàn)多態(tài)性。
- php教程 . 后端開發(fā) 1095 2025-05-20 18:24:01
-
- PHP中如何操作CSV文件?
- 在PHP中操作CSV文件主要通過fgetcsv和fputcsv函數(shù)實現(xiàn)。1)讀取CSV文件使用fgetcsv函數(shù),逐行讀取并處理數(shù)據(jù)。2)寫入CSV文件使用fputcsv函數(shù),將數(shù)組數(shù)據(jù)寫入文件。注意文件編碼和大文件處理時使用逐行讀取以優(yōu)化性能。
- php教程 . 后端開發(fā) 478 2025-05-20 18:21:01
-
- PHP中array_product怎么計算數(shù)組積?
- 在PHP中,可以使用array_product函數(shù)計算數(shù)組中所有元素的乘積。1)它高效處理大數(shù)據(jù)集,適用于計算投資組合回報率和統(tǒng)計乘積。2)注意數(shù)據(jù)類型,非數(shù)字元素會被轉(zhuǎn)換為0。3)大數(shù)乘積會轉(zhuǎn)換為浮點數(shù),可能影響精度。4)對于大數(shù)組,性能尚可,但頻繁計算時需考慮其他方法。5)在金融分析中,可用于計算百分比總乘積。
- php教程 . 后端開發(fā) 1231 2025-05-20 18:18:01
-
- PHP中如何避免SQL注入?
- 在PHP中避免SQL注入可以通過以下方法:1.使用參數(shù)化查詢(PreparedStatements),如PDO示例所示。2.使用ORM庫,如Doctrine或Eloquent,自動處理SQL注入。3.驗證和過濾用戶輸入,防止其他攻擊類型。
- php教程 . 后端開發(fā) 838 2025-05-20 18:15:01
-
- PHP變量的作用域有哪些?
- PHP變量的作用域主要包括全局作用域和局部作用域。1.全局作用域指在函數(shù)外部定義的變量,可在整個腳本中訪問和修改。2.局部作用域指在函數(shù)內(nèi)部定義的變量,僅在該函數(shù)內(nèi)有效。理解和正確使用這些作用域有助于編寫更清晰和高效的代碼。
- php教程 . 后端開發(fā) 600 2025-05-20 18:12:02
-
- PHP中array_walk怎么遍歷修改數(shù)組?
- array_walk在PHP中用于遍歷和修改數(shù)組。1)通過回調(diào)函數(shù)可以修改數(shù)組元素,如將字符串轉(zhuǎn)為大寫或數(shù)值乘以常數(shù)。2)回調(diào)函數(shù)需使用引用參數(shù)以修改原始數(shù)組。3)適用于復(fù)雜數(shù)組處理,但需注意性能和可讀性。
- php教程 . 后端開發(fā) 756 2025-05-20 18:09:01
-
- PHP中如何實現(xiàn)數(shù)組分組?
- 在PHP中,可以使用array_reduce函數(shù)結(jié)合匿名函數(shù)來實現(xiàn)數(shù)組分組。1)使用array_reduce函數(shù)進行分組,靈活且高效。2)對于大數(shù)據(jù)量,考慮性能時,可使用傳統(tǒng)循環(huán)或數(shù)據(jù)庫查詢。3)處理鍵值沖突時,使用復(fù)合鍵進行區(qū)分。此方法適合靈活性需求高的場景。
- php教程 . 后端開發(fā) 1061 2025-05-20 18:06:01
-
- PHP中如何驗證電子郵件字符串?
- 在PHP中,驗證電子郵件字符串可以通過filter_var函數(shù)實現(xiàn),但需要結(jié)合其他方法提高驗證的有效性。1)使用filter_var函數(shù)進行初步格式驗證。2)通過checkdnsrr函數(shù)進行DNS驗證。3)采用SMTP協(xié)議進行更準確的驗證。4)謹慎使用正則表達式進行格式驗證。5)考慮性能和用戶體驗,建議在注冊時初步驗證,后續(xù)通過發(fā)送驗證郵件確認有效性。
- php教程 . 后端開發(fā) 729 2025-05-20 18:03:01
-
- PHP中如何驗證MAC地址字符串?
- PHP中驗證MAC地址字符串的方法是使用正則表達式和字符串處理函數(shù)。1.移除所有非十六進制字符。2.檢查字符串長度是否為12。3.驗證格式是否符合MAC地址標準,這種方法既靈活又安全。
- php教程 . 后端開發(fā) 855 2025-05-20 18:00:03
-
- PHP中如何實現(xiàn)數(shù)據(jù)導(dǎo)入?
- 在PHP中實現(xiàn)數(shù)據(jù)導(dǎo)入可以通過以下步驟實現(xiàn):1)使用fgetcsv函數(shù)讀取CSV文件,逐行處理數(shù)據(jù);2)使用PhpSpreadsheet庫讀取Excel文件,遍歷單元格數(shù)據(jù)。需要注意數(shù)據(jù)格式、一致性、性能和錯誤處理等挑戰(zhàn),并遵循使用事務(wù)、批量操作、數(shù)據(jù)驗證、日志記錄和用戶反饋的最佳實踐。
- php教程 . 后端開發(fā) 921 2025-05-20 17:57:01
-
- PHP中如何解析字符串?
- 解析字符串在PHP中是非常常見且重要的操作,無論你是處理用戶輸入、讀取文件內(nèi)容,還是與數(shù)據(jù)庫交互,都會用到它。今天我們就來深入探討一下PHP中解析字符串的各種方法和技巧。在PHP中,解析字符串可以有多種方式,從簡單的字符串函數(shù)到正則表達式,再到更復(fù)雜的解析庫,每種方法都有其獨特的應(yīng)用場景和優(yōu)缺點。讓我們從最基礎(chǔ)的開始,逐步深入到更復(fù)雜的解析技術(shù)。首先,我們來看一下PHP中最常用的字符串函數(shù)。這些函數(shù)簡單易用,適合處理基本的字符串操作。比如,explode()函數(shù)可以將字符串按指定的分隔符拆分成數(shù)
- php教程 . 后端開發(fā) 479 2025-05-20 17:54:01
-
- PHP中如何實現(xiàn)數(shù)組MessagePack解碼?
- 在PHP中實現(xiàn)數(shù)組的MessagePack解碼需要使用php-msgpack庫。1.通過Composer引入庫。2.創(chuàng)建BufferUnpacker對象并加載二進制數(shù)據(jù)。3.調(diào)用unpack方法進行解碼,輸出結(jié)果。
- php教程 . 后端開發(fā) 280 2025-05-20 17:51:01
工具推薦

